亚洲国产日韩欧美一区二区三区,精品亚洲国产成人av在线,国产99视频精品免视看7,99国产精品久久久久久久成人热,欧美日韩亚洲国产综合乱

目錄
引言
HTML 基礎(chǔ)回顧
HTML 標(biāo)籤與屬性的解析
標(biāo)籤與屬性的定義與作用
工作原理
使用示例
基本用法
高級用法
常見錯誤與調(diào)試技巧
性能優(yōu)化與最佳實(shí)踐
首頁 web前端 html教學(xué) 舉一個帶有屬性的HTML標(biāo)籤的示例。

舉一個帶有屬性的HTML標(biāo)籤的示例。

May 16, 2025 am 12:02 AM
html標(biāo)籤 html屬性

HTML 標(biāo)籤和屬性的使用方法包括:1. 基本用法:使用標(biāo)籤如<img src="/static/imghw/default1.png" data-src="image.jpg" class="lazy" alt="舉一個帶有屬性的HTML標(biāo)籤的示例。" >和<a>,通過屬性如src和href添加必要信息。 2. 高級用法:使用data-*自定義屬性實(shí)現(xiàn)複雜交互。 3. 避免常見錯誤:確保屬性值用引號包圍。 4. 性能優(yōu)化:保持簡潔,使用標(biāo)準(zhǔn)屬性和CSS類名,確保圖像有alt屬性。掌握這些將提升網(wǎng)頁開發(fā)技能。

引言

在編程的世界裡,HTML 無疑是構(gòu)建網(wǎng)頁的基石。今天,我們將深入探討HTML 標(biāo)籤和屬性這一看似簡單卻極其重要的概念。無論你是初學(xué)者還是經(jīng)驗(yàn)豐富的開發(fā)者,理解標(biāo)籤和屬性的使用將大大提升你的網(wǎng)頁開發(fā)技能。通過這篇文章,你將學(xué)會如何在HTML 中使用標(biāo)籤和屬性,了解它們的作用,並掌握一些常見但容易被忽略的細(xì)節(jié)。

HTML 基礎(chǔ)回顧

HTML 是HyperText Markup Language 的縮寫,用於描述網(wǎng)頁的結(jié)構(gòu)。網(wǎng)頁由各種HTML 元素組成,這些元素通常由開始標(biāo)籤和結(jié)束標(biāo)籤包圍。標(biāo)籤之間可以包含文本內(nèi)容、其他標(biāo)籤或兩者兼有。屬性則為標(biāo)籤提供了額外的信息或功能,通常出現(xiàn)在開始標(biāo)籤內(nèi)。

例如, <img src="/static/imghw/default1.png" data-src="image.jpg" class="lazy" alt="舉一個帶有屬性的HTML標(biāo)籤的示例。" >標(biāo)籤用於在網(wǎng)頁上嵌入圖像,它的src屬性指定了圖像的源URL, alt屬性提供了圖像的替代文本。

HTML 標(biāo)籤與屬性的解析

標(biāo)籤與屬性的定義與作用

HTML 標(biāo)籤是網(wǎng)頁結(jié)構(gòu)的基本構(gòu)建塊,它們定義了內(nèi)容的類型和結(jié)構(gòu)。屬性則為標(biāo)籤添加了額外的信息或行為,增強(qiáng)了標(biāo)籤的功能性和可訪問性。

例如, <a></a>標(biāo)籤定義了超鏈接, href屬性指定了鏈接的目標(biāo)URL。沒有href屬性,這個標(biāo)籤就無法實(shí)現(xiàn)鏈接功能。

 <a href="https://www.example.com">Visit Example.com</a>

這個例子中, <a>標(biāo)籤通過href屬性變成了一個可點(diǎn)擊的鏈接,指向https://www.example.com

工作原理

當(dāng)瀏覽器解析HTML 時,它會識別標(biāo)籤並根據(jù)標(biāo)籤的類型和屬性來渲染頁面。例如,瀏覽器看到<img src="/static/imghw/default1.png" data-src="image.jpg" class="lazy" alt="舉一個帶有屬性的HTML標(biāo)籤的示例。" >標(biāo)籤時,會根據(jù)src屬性的值去請求並顯示圖像。如果src屬性不存在或路徑錯誤,瀏覽器會顯示alt屬性的文本作為替代。

屬性值通常用雙引號或單引號包圍,瀏覽器在解析時會忽略引號之間的空格,因此src=&#39;image.jpg&#39;是等價的。

使用示例

基本用法

最常見的標(biāo)籤和屬性使用是為圖像和鏈接添加必要的信息。

 <img src="/static/imghw/default1.png"  data-src="logo.png"  class="lazy" alt="Company Logo">
<a href="contact.html">Contact Us</a>

在這個例子中, <img alt="舉一個帶有屬性的HTML標(biāo)籤的示例。" >標(biāo)籤的src屬性指定了圖像文件的路徑, alt屬性提供了圖像的描述文本。 <a>標(biāo)籤的href屬性定義了鏈接的目標(biāo)頁面。

高級用法

屬性不僅可以用於基本功能,還可以實(shí)現(xiàn)更複雜的交互和樣式控制。例如,使用data-*自定義屬性來存儲額外的數(shù)據(jù):

 <div id="product" data-price="29.99" data-category="electronics">
    <h2>Smartphone</h2>
    <p>Price: $<span data-bind="price"></span></p>
</div>

在這個例子中, data-pricedata-category屬性可以被JavaScript 讀取和使用,實(shí)現(xiàn)動態(tài)內(nèi)容更新或分類過濾。

常見錯誤與調(diào)試技巧

一個常見的錯誤是忘記為屬性值添加引號,特別是在屬性值包含空格或特殊字符時:

 <!-- 錯誤示例-->
<img src=image with space.jpg alt=Image with space>

<!-- 正確示例-->
<img src="image with space.jpg" alt="Image with space">

調(diào)試時,可以使用瀏覽器的開發(fā)者工具查看HTML 結(jié)構(gòu)和屬性,快速發(fā)現(xiàn)和修正錯誤。

性能優(yōu)化與最佳實(shí)踐

在使用標(biāo)籤和屬性時,保持簡潔和語義化是關(guān)鍵。避免使用過多的自定義屬性,因?yàn)樗鼈兛赡茉黾禹撁婕虞d時間和復(fù)雜性。相反,應(yīng)該盡可能利用標(biāo)準(zhǔn)的HTML 屬性和CSS 類名來實(shí)現(xiàn)功能和樣式。

例如,使用class屬性而不是data-*屬性來控製樣式:

 <!-- 推薦做法-->
<div class="product electronics">
    <h2>Smartphone</h2>
    <p>Price: $29.99</p>
</div>

<!-- 不推薦做法-->
<div data-category="electronics">
    <h2>Smartphone</h2>
    <p>Price: $<span data-bind="price"></span></p>
</div>

此外,確保所有圖像都有alt屬性,以提高網(wǎng)頁的可訪問性和SEO 性能。

通過這篇文章的學(xué)習(xí),你應(yīng)該對HTML 標(biāo)籤和屬性的使用有了更深入的理解。無論是基本的還是高級的應(yīng)用場景,掌握這些知識將幫助你構(gòu)建更高效、更易維護(hù)的網(wǎng)頁。

以上是舉一個帶有屬性的HTML標(biāo)籤的示例。的詳細(xì)內(nèi)容。更多資訊請關(guān)注PHP中文網(wǎng)其他相關(guān)文章!

本網(wǎng)站聲明
本文內(nèi)容由網(wǎng)友自願投稿,版權(quán)歸原作者所有。本站不承擔(dān)相應(yīng)的法律責(zé)任。如發(fā)現(xiàn)涉嫌抄襲或侵權(quán)的內(nèi)容,請聯(lián)絡(luò)admin@php.cn

熱AI工具

Undress AI Tool

Undress AI Tool

免費(fèi)脫衣圖片

Undresser.AI Undress

Undresser.AI Undress

人工智慧驅(qū)動的應(yīng)用程序,用於創(chuàng)建逼真的裸體照片

AI Clothes Remover

AI Clothes Remover

用於從照片中去除衣服的線上人工智慧工具。

Clothoff.io

Clothoff.io

AI脫衣器

Video Face Swap

Video Face Swap

使用我們完全免費(fèi)的人工智慧換臉工具,輕鬆在任何影片中換臉!

熱工具

記事本++7.3.1

記事本++7.3.1

好用且免費(fèi)的程式碼編輯器

SublimeText3漢化版

SublimeText3漢化版

中文版,非常好用

禪工作室 13.0.1

禪工作室 13.0.1

強(qiáng)大的PHP整合開發(fā)環(huán)境

Dreamweaver CS6

Dreamweaver CS6

視覺化網(wǎng)頁開發(fā)工具

SublimeText3 Mac版

SublimeText3 Mac版

神級程式碼編輯軟體(SublimeText3)

如何在Go語言中使用正規(guī)表示式擷取HTML標(biāo)籤內(nèi)容 如何在Go語言中使用正規(guī)表示式擷取HTML標(biāo)籤內(nèi)容 Jul 14, 2023 pm 01:18 PM

如何在Go語言中使用正規(guī)表示式擷取HTML標(biāo)籤內(nèi)容導(dǎo)讀:正規(guī)表示式是一種強(qiáng)大的文字比對工具,它在Go語言中也有著廣泛的應(yīng)用。在處理HTML標(biāo)籤的場景中,正規(guī)表示式可以幫助我們快速擷取所需的內(nèi)容。本文將介紹如何在Go語言中使用正規(guī)表示式擷取HTML標(biāo)籤的內(nèi)容,並給予相關(guān)程式碼範(fàn)例。一、引入相關(guān)套件首先,我們需要導(dǎo)入相關(guān)的套件:regexp和fmt。 regexp包提供

如何使用Python正規(guī)表示式去除HTML標(biāo)籤 如何使用Python正規(guī)表示式去除HTML標(biāo)籤 Jun 22, 2023 am 08:44 AM

HTML(HyperTextMarkupLanguage)是用於建立Web頁面的標(biāo)準(zhǔn)語言,它使用標(biāo)籤和屬性來描述頁面上的各種元素,例如文字、圖像、表格和連結(jié)等等。但是,在處理HTML文字時,很難將其中的文字內(nèi)容快速地提取出來用於後續(xù)的處理。這時,我們可以使用Python中的正規(guī)表示式來移除HTML標(biāo)籤,以達(dá)到快速擷取純文字的目的。在Python中,正規(guī)表

PHP如何去除字串中的HTML標(biāo)籤? PHP如何去除字串中的HTML標(biāo)籤? Mar 23, 2024 pm 09:03 PM

PHP是一種常用的伺服器端腳本語言,廣泛應(yīng)用於網(wǎng)站開發(fā)和後端應(yīng)用程式開發(fā)。在開發(fā)網(wǎng)站或應(yīng)用程式時,經(jīng)常會遇到需要處理字串中的HTML標(biāo)籤的情況。本文將介紹如何使用PHP去除字串中的HTML標(biāo)籤,並提供具體的程式碼範(fàn)例。為什麼需要移除HTML標(biāo)籤?在處理使用者輸入或從資料庫中取得的文字時,經(jīng)常會包含HTML標(biāo)籤。有時我們希望在顯示文字時移除這些HTML標(biāo)籤

PHP正規(guī)表示式實(shí)戰(zhàn):符合HTML屬性 PHP正規(guī)表示式實(shí)戰(zhàn):符合HTML屬性 Jun 22, 2023 pm 09:29 PM

在網(wǎng)頁開發(fā)中,HTML屬性是非常重要的元素之一。然而,在實(shí)際開發(fā)中,經(jīng)常需要對屬性進(jìn)行匹配和提取。這時候,正規(guī)表示式就成為了一個非常有效的工具。本文將介紹如何使用PHP正規(guī)表示式來符合HTML屬性,並結(jié)合實(shí)際案例進(jìn)行解說。首先,我們需要了解HTML屬性的一般結(jié)構(gòu)。一個HTML屬性通常由屬性名稱和屬性值組成,中間用等號連接。例如:class="container

如何在Java中從給定的字串中刪除HTML標(biāo)籤? 如何在Java中從給定的字串中刪除HTML標(biāo)籤? Aug 29, 2023 pm 06:05 PM

String是Java中的final類,它是不可變的,這意味著我們不能改變物件本身,但我們可以更改物件的引用。可以使用String類別的replaceAll()方法從給定字串中刪除HTML標(biāo)籤。我們可以使用正規(guī)表示式從給定字串中刪除HTML標(biāo)記。從字串中刪除HTML標(biāo)籤後,它將傳回一個字串作為普通文字。語法publicStringreplaceAll(Stringregex,Stringreplacement)範(fàn)例publicclassRemoveHTMLTagsTest{&nbs

php中怎麼轉(zhuǎn)義html標(biāo)籤 php中怎麼轉(zhuǎn)義html標(biāo)籤 Feb 24, 2021 pm 06:00 PM

在PHP中,可以使用htmlentities()函數(shù)來轉(zhuǎn)義html,能把字元轉(zhuǎn)換成HTML實(shí)體,語法「htmlentities(string,flags,character-set,double_encode)」。 PHP中也可以使用html_entity_decode()函數(shù)來反轉(zhuǎn)義html,把HTML實(shí)體轉(zhuǎn)換成字元。

Vue中使用$attrs傳遞HTML屬性 Vue中使用$attrs傳遞HTML屬性 Jun 11, 2023 am 11:35 AM

Vue是一款流行的JavaScript框架,用於建立現(xiàn)代的Web應(yīng)用程式。 Vue提供了一個強(qiáng)大的元件系統(tǒng),可讓您將UI元素分解為可重複使用的元件,並以可維護(hù)的方式組合它們。 Vue的元件系統(tǒng)也提供了一種方便的方式來在元件之間傳遞資料和屬性。其中一個非常有用的屬性傳遞方式是$attrs。 $attrs是Vue提供的一個特殊對象,用於將組件的HTML屬性傳遞到其子組

HTML中起始標(biāo)籤的示例是什麼? HTML中起始標(biāo)籤的示例是什麼? Apr 06, 2025 am 12:04 AM

AnexampleOfAstartingTaginHtmlis,beginSaparagraph.startingTagSareEssentialInhtmlastheyInitiateEllements,defiteTheeTheErtypes,andarecrucialforsstructuringwebpages wepages webpages andConstructingthedom。

See all articles